What is a junior frontend web developer?

Junior Frontend Web Developers are entry-level professionals who specialize in building and maintaining the visual and interactive parts of websites and web applications. They work with technologies like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ript to implement user interfaces based on designs provided by UX/UI teams. Typically, they collaborate with senior developers and designers, fix bugs, and learn to apply best practices in web development. Junior developers are expected to continuously improve their coding skills and stay updated with the latest frontend trends.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a junior frontend web developer?

To thrive as a Junior Frontend Web Developer, you need a solid grasp of H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, often supported by a degree in computer science or a coding bootcamp certificate. Familiarity with frameworks like React or Vue.js, version control systems like Git, and task runners is typically required. Str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and effective communication help you collaborate and deliver user-friendly interfaces. These competencies ensure that web applications are functional, visually appealing, and maintainable within team-driven development environments.

What types of projects and technologies will I typically work with as a junior frontend web developer?

As a Junior Frontend Web Developer, you will usually work on building and maintaining user interfaces for websites and web applications using technologies such as HTML, CSS, and JavaScript. You'll often collaborate with designers to implement visual elements and work with more experienced developers to integrate APIs or backend services. Common tasks include fixing bugs, developing responsive layouts, and ensuring cross-browser compatibility. You'll also likely use frameworks like React, Vue, or Angular, gaining exposure to modern development tools and best practices in agile team environments.

What is the difference between Junior Frontend Web Developer vs Junior Web Designer?

AspectJunior Frontend Web DeveloperJunior Web Designer
Primary FocusBuilding and coding website features using HTML, CSS, JavaScriptDesigning website layouts, visual elements, and user interfaces
Skills & CertificationsHTML, CSS, JavaScript, basic coding knowledgeDesign tools (Photoshop, Sketch), UI/UX principles
Work EnvironmentCollaborates with developers and backend teams in tech companiesWorks closely with clients and marketing teams in creative agencies
Common UsageOften searched as Junior Frontend Developer vs Junior Web DesignerOften searched as Junior Web Designer vs Junior Frontend Web Developer

The main difference between a Junior Frontend Web Developer and a Junior Web Designer lies in their focus: developers code and build website functionalities, while designers create visual layouts and user interfaces. Both roles require some overlapping skills but serve distinct purposes in web development projects.

Job description

Job Title: Frontend Web Developer II
Location: HYBRID in Cincinnati, Charlotte, or Chicago
TOP SKILLS:
Must Have
CCS and HTML hands on experience
Knowledge of AEM and web pages development
Mobile/Web Development
What You'll Do
Collaborates with Line of Business (LOB) and Centers of Excellence (COE) to define requirements and ensure integrity and functionality of assigned web projects, with the ability to manage multiple projects and deadlines simultaneously.
Manages the Content Management System (CMS), Adobe Experience Manager (AEM)
Utilizes the brand design library to support brand, component, and layout consistency and functionality on 53.com.
Creates user interfaces (UI) and user experiences (UX) for unauthenticated 53.com by implementing creative, intuitive solutions that support LOB and business needs in collaboration with senior developers and the design teams.
Writes basic JavaScript functions to support and enhance content and 53.com user experience (UX).
Manages relationships with vendors related to job function and Fifth Third Bank Information Technology partners.
Assists with and manages various marketing technologies and marketing technology vendor relationships.
Works with Information Technology partners to support personalization.
Utilizes the Adobe Experience Manager (AEM) Content Management System (CMS) to apply component and layout standards to pre-defined templates.
Maintains an ongoing awareness of current web design, digital design trends, and best practices.
Provides design leadership and oversight to both internal and external resources.
Utilizes basic analytics to support and optimize user experience (UX) across 53.com.
Manages day-to-day maintenance tasks in a timely manner.
Experience with Adobe Experience Manager, Adobe Target, Adobe Analytics, Microsoft Office Suite, Adobe Creative Suite, and Pattern Lab.
Supports SEO and optimization objectives.
Conduct accessibility audits/checks to ensure compliance with WCAG and ADA standards (PDFs, webpages, etc).
QA (testing, reporting, tracking, ensuring compliance and standards)
Other duties as required.
